Web12 dec. 2024 · Repatha and Praluent work by blocking PCSK9, which means more receptors are available to remove LDL-C (low-density lipoprotein cholesterol) from the blood. This results in lower LDL cholesterol levels. LDL_C is sometimes described as bad cholesterol because it collects in the walls of the arteries leading to your heart. Web21 jan. 2024 · A. Evolocumab (Repatha) is a relatively new injectable cholesterol-lowering medicine. Web24 aug. 2024 · You can inject Repatha into your belly, thigh, or upper arm. But avoid injecting the medication in areas where your skin is irritated, bruised, tender, or … Web1 feb. 2024 · It is also used in patients with a heart and blood vessel disease to reduce the risk of heart attack, stroke, and certain types of heart surgery. This medicine is a PCSK9 (proprotein convertase subtilisin kexin type 9) inhibitor. This medicine is available only with your doctor's prescription. Stop taking REPATHA and call your healthcare provider or seek emergency medical help right away if you or your child have any of these symptoms: o trouble breathing or swallowing o raised bumps (hives) csub 25liveWeb8 jun. 2024 · PCSK9 inhibitors work via a pathway different from statin medications, and may be used together. The FDA approved two PCSK9 inhibitors in 2015: alirocumab (Praluent) and evolocumab (Repatha). These drugs must be given by injection, typically every two to four weeks.
